> > On 31 March 2007, the Verio routing registry database was renamed > > NTTCOM. This change of name has been incorporated in the RIPE Database > > server which mirrors a number of public databases including the NTTCOM > > routing registry. > > > > More information about the NTTCOM routing registry is available at: > > http://www.us.ntt.net/about/policy/rr.cfm > > how/when will that affect us poor peval() users? > > `/usr/local/bin/peval -s $IRR $OBJ > > do we just change $IRR from VERIO to NTTCOM and it will all work? yes Assuming that defaults/environment/additional flags in appropriate position for the database host and access protocol (radb ./. ripe) are right that should do it - and I can report success using peval/RtConfig derivatives for a couple of days. > randy Cheers, Ruediger
